Brittany Snow Short biography
Brittany Anne Snow (born March 9, 1986) is an American actress, singer, writer, director, and producer. She gained recognition for her roles as Susan "Daisy" Lemay in "Guiding Light" (1998–2001) and Margaret "Meg" Pryor in "American Dreams" (2002–2005). Snow is widely known for playing Chloe Beale in the "Pitch Perfect" film series (2012–2017). Her film credits also include "John Tucker Must Die" (2006), "Hairspray" (2007), "Prom Night" (2008), "Would You Rather" (2012), and "X" (2022). She made her directorial debut with "Parachute" (2023) and also co-wrote and produced the upcoming film "September 17th." Snow has also lent her voice to video games like "Kingdom Hearts II". She is the co-founder of the Love Is Louder movement, a project by the Jed Foundation aimed at combating bullying and addressing mental health issues. Snow married Tyler Stanaland in 2020; they separated in 2022 and finalized their divorce in 2023.
